Output 64caae8d5627bf67964b4044563fa53ee6369fa869fdffc441a2d73a3ccaa002:0
- value
- 644230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ba83b0860dec195500987c69ad03a4f254400bb8 OP_EQUAL
- address
- 3JhDNB4QajsGU8vkWiw5J4JJzhsxbsuSSC
- transaction
- 64caae8d5627bf67964b4044563fa53ee6369fa869fdffc441a2d73a3ccaa002
- confirmations
- 323335
- spent
- true